Kurdran Wildhammer (and Sky'ree), Chief Thane of the Wildhammer Clan and one of the Sons of Lothar.

Probably the simplest of the Sons of Lothar models, but I do like how he looks. I was planning on making separate versions of Kurdran and Sky'ree but got kind of burnt out. Might pick it up again at some point.

CHANGELOG:
  • September 4th 2022 - Added custom missile model
  • September 5th 2022 - Optimized model by removing unused keyframes
  • February 5th 2023 - Made missile model pass sanity check
